How Our Water Damage Assessment Service Works

Our Water Damage Assessment service is a crucial step in the restoration process. It involves a thorough inspection of your property to identify the source of the water, assess the extent of the damage, and create a plan for mitigation. We use specialized equipment, such as thermal imaging cameras and moisture meters, to detect hidden water damage and prevent mold growth.

Step 1: Inspection and Assessment

Our technicians will conduct a thorough inspection of your property to identify the source of the water and assess the extent of the damage. They'll use specialized equipment to detect hidden water damage and prevent mold growth. This step typically takes 30-60 minutes, depending on the size of the affected area.

Step 2: Moisture Mapping

Our technicians will use thermal imaging cameras to create a Moisture Map of your property. This map helps identify areas with high moisture levels, which can lead to mold growth and further damage. This step typically takes 30-60 minutes, depending on the size of the affected area.

Step 3: Containment and Drying

Our technicians will contain the affected area to prevent further damage and drying. They'll use specialized equipment, such as dehumidifiers and air movers, to remove excess moisture and speed up the drying process. This step typically takes 3-5 days, depending on the severity of the damage.

Step 4: Cleanup and Repair

Our technicians will clean and repair any damaged surfaces, including walls, floors, and ceilings. They'll use specialized equipment and techniques to remove any remaining water and prevent mold growth. This step typically takes 1-3 days, depending on the extent of the damage.

Warning Signs You Need Water Damage Assessment

Ignoring warning signs can lead to costly repairs and health risks. Don't wait until it's too late. Our team can help you identify and address the following warning signs:

Musty Odors That Won't Go Away

Musty odors are a clear sign of water damage. If you notice a persistent musty smell in your home, it's essential to investigate the source and address it quickly. Water damage can lead to mold growth, which can cause health problems and further damage.

Warped or Discolored Drywall

Warped or discolored drywall is a sign of water damage. If you notice any changes in the appearance of your drywall, it's essential to inspect the area thoroughly and address any damage quickly. Water damage can lead to structural issues and further damage if left unchecked.

Peeling Paint or Wallpaper

Peeling paint or wallpaper is a sign of water damage. If you notice any changes in the appearance of your paint or wallpaper, it's essential to inspect the area thoroughly and address any damage quickly. Water damage can lead to structural issues and further damage if left unchecked.

Water Stains on Ceilings or Walls

Water stains on ceilings or walls are a sign of water damage. If you notice any water stains, it's essential to investigate the source and address it quickly. Water damage can lead to structural issues and further damage if left unchecked.

Mold Growth in Hidden Areas

Mold growth in hidden areas is a sign of water damage. If you notice any signs of mold growth in areas that are difficult to access, such as behind walls or under flooring, it's essential to address the issue quickly. Mold growth can lead to health problems and further damage if left unchecked.

Water Damage Assessment v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Visible water damage in a small area (less than 100 sqft) Yes No DIY fixes can be effective for small areas.
Water damage in a large area (over 100 sqft) No Yes Professional help is necessary for extensive water damage.
Hidden water damage (e.g., behind walls or under flooring) No Yes Professional equipment is necessary to detect hidden water damage.
Mold growth in areas difficult to access No Yes Professional help is necessary to safely remove mold growth in hidden areas.
Water damage caused by a burst pipe or appliance failure No Yes Professional help is necessary to repair or replace damaged appliances and pipes.

While DIY fixes can be effective for small areas, it's essential to call a professional for extensive water damage, hidden water damage, or mold growth in difficult-to-access areas. Water Damage Assessment Cost in Grinnell, IA

The cost of Water Damage Assessment in Grinnell, IA can vary depending on the severity and extent of the damage. Our typical price range for Water Damage Assessment is $500 - $2,500, depending on the size of the affected area and the extent of the damage. The cost of mitigation and restoration can range from $1,000 to $10,000 or more, depending on the scope of the project.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Inspect and Assess $500 - $1,500 Size of affected area and extent of damage
Moisture Mapping $200 - $1,000 Size of affected area and complexity of map
Contain and Dry $1,000 - $5,000 Size of affected area and severity of damage
Cleanup and Repair $1,500 - $6,000 Size of affected area and extent of damage
